V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  anonymous256  ›  全部回复第 2 页 / 共 34 页
回复总数  672
1  2  3  4  5  6  7  8  9  10 ... 34  
2022-01-21 19:52:47 +08:00
回复了 IurNusRay 创建的主题 Python Python 程序如何定位到 cpu 占用过高的代码呢
一般说来,web 服务不涉及 CPU 密集型的任务。比较依赖 CPU 资源的主要在于解码或数学计算类的任务。所以即便你找到了好工具,很可能也解决和发现什么问题。

大多数程序性能的障碍在于:内存数据的写读依赖,不必要的计算和循环,算法的选择,不必要的 I/O 操作,多进程的数据竞争。你可以在程序内用通过日志输出高精度的时间,直接来捕捉到影响性能关键的代码区域,重新看代码逻辑分析具体是什么原因。

以「不必要的计算和循环」为例,我就遇到这样的代码,比如明明一个 for 循环就可以直接完成 AB 操作。但是有的程序员,会先写一个 for 循环执行 A 操作,再来一次 for 循环执行 B 操作。就导致了无谓的双倍内存访问。在比如明明一次 SQL 查询就能解决问题,他要查询两次,然后对数据进行关联和处理。就是不必要的操作和计算。

通常情况,性能的问题是人的问题。
2022-01-21 16:53:35 +08:00
回复了 ruanruan 创建的主题 成都 新人求教成都的互联网企业卷不卷
国内就没有不卷的公司,只是程度的差异不同。
有些公司迭代的节奏相对慢一点。
现在的安卓早已不是性能问题了,而是缺乏统一的应用市场和严格的审核机制。
由此导致了良莠不齐的 APP——各种广告,索取权限和侵犯隐私,无底线的唤醒和消息通知。
2022-01-18 17:18:33 +08:00
回复了 xiayushengfan 创建的主题 问与答 跪求一份 PPT 关于 跨境在线交易
2022-01-18 17:05:59 +08:00
回复了 psyer 创建的主题 分享发现 数据分析, R 是否比 Python 强?
个人觉得 Python 更好用。
R 的数据结构虽然丰富,向量,矩阵,frame 各种,但是它的数据操作不方便。没有像 Python 那样简单便捷的函数方法。用 R 的时候经常要 Google ,找库和复制代码。不像 Python ,Python 就算没有现成的库,自己写起来应该也很方便。
@shm7 #103 “无法可依,有法不依” 说到点子上了。
中国自改革开放之后发展迅速,996 的劳工现状却持续了快 30 年了。高速发展的背后,牺牲的是普普通通的劳动力和企业员工,他们用个人健康和大量的个人时间投入换来的一些薪水。收入与工作中付出不成比例,即便工伤或者职业病也很难维权,无法可依,有法不依。最典型的是 2009 年张海超“开胸验肺”事件。然而十年过去了,工人的工作环境还是很糟糕。
2021-10-12 19:23:01 +08:00
回复了 NeverBoom 创建的主题 生活 我想逃避现实
关于这一点“ 什么狗屁代码规范,能跑就行;什么测试,我直接线上服务器改,反正狗屁业务在线用户不到几十”,你的工作态度不够好。 我过去在公司写的 Python 代码,没有不符合 PEP8 规范的。这和领导批评不批评没有关系,自己的事,总归要自己负起责任。
1  2  3  4  5  6  7  8  9  10 ... 34  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1047 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 33ms · UTC 23:21 · PVG 07:21 · LAX 15:21 · JFK 18:21
Developed with CodeLauncher
♥ Do have faith in what you're doing.